The unique blend of freshwater rivers, tidal creeks, salt marshes, and easy access to the Atlantic ensures year-round action and a diverse range of target species.
St. Marys fishing charters are celebrated for their access to unspoiled habitats and minimal fishing pressure, making every trip both peaceful and productive. Inshore anglers can explore winding creeks and marshes teeming with Redfish, Spotted Seatrout, Flounder, Black Drum, Sheepshead, and Whiting. The expansive flats and shell bars are prime spots for a trophy catch, while the legendary Crooked River State Park offers some of the best shore fishing in the state.
For those seeking adventure, the offshore and nearshore waters around Cumberland Island hold exciting possibilities, from Tarpon and Sharks in the warmer months to Kingfish and Snapper further out.
